| 21 | /* |
| 22 | * __cpu_soft_restart(el2_switch, entry, arg0, arg1, arg2) - Helper for |
| 23 | * cpu_soft_restart. |
| 24 | * |
| 25 | * @el2_switch: Flag to indicate a swich to EL2 is needed. |
| 26 | * @entry: Location to jump to for soft reset. |
| 27 | * arg0: First argument passed to @entry. |
| 28 | * arg1: Second argument passed to @entry. |
| 29 | * arg2: Third argument passed to @entry. |
| 30 | * |
| 31 | * Put the CPU into the same state as it would be if it had been reset, and |
| 32 | * branch to what would be the reset vector. It must be executed with the |
| 33 | * flat identity mapping. |
| 34 | */ |
| 35 | ENTRY(__cpu_soft_restart) |
| 36 | /* Clear sctlr_el1 flags. */ |
| 37 | mrs x12, sctlr_el1 |
| 38 | ldr x13, =SCTLR_ELx_FLAGS |
| 39 | bic x12, x12, x13 |
| 40 | msr sctlr_el1, x12 |
| 41 | isb |
| 42 | |
| 43 | cbz x0, 1f // el2_switch? |
| 44 | mov x0, #HVC_SOFT_RESTART |
| 45 | hvc #0 // no return |
| 46 | |
| 47 | 1: mov x18, x1 // entry |
| 48 | mov x0, x2 // arg0 |
| 49 | mov x1, x3 // arg1 |
| 50 | mov x2, x4 // arg2 |
| 51 | br x18 |
| 52 | ENDPROC(__cpu_soft_restart) |
